A component speaker system gives you the best possible performance from your car audio system. A system consists of separate woofers, tweeters, and crossovers, each designed to cover one specific range of frequencies. As separate components, the woofer can move freely to deliver more powerful performance, while the tweeter can be custom-mounted in a better spot up closer to your ears, revealing a whole new world of detail. Separate crossovers are far superior to the simple filters wired into full-range speakers, so the components work together for smoother, more focused sound. Woofers Tweeters Crossovers Woofers Aluminum-coated Polypropylene Woofer Cones: The aluminum-coated polypropylene woofer cones have strength and quick response that is enhanced by the high-excursion magnet design. The parabolic cone design offers accurate bass reproduction. Extra Large Rubber Surrounds: The extra large rubber surrounds enable low frequency bass reproduction and maximum cone excursion. Cast Aluminum Frames: Each woofer is mounted to a custom cast aluminum frame for added strength and maximum bass reproduction. Tweeters 1" Silk Dome Tweeters: The 1" silk dome tweeters offer clean, non-fatiguing sound even under extreme high frequency demands. Standard Tweeter Mounting Options: The tweeters may be flush or surface mounted. Once mounted, the tweeters are adjustable and may be swiveled 20 degrees for optimum imaging.
